Control system for vehicle
A control system is intended for a vehicle having an automatic stop-restart function that automatically stops an engine when a predetermined automatic stop condition is satisfied and restarts the engine when a predetermined restart condition is satisfied during an automatic engine stop. The control system has an automatic stop restricting function that, when the host vehicle is located in a first predetermined area before a temporary stop sign, prohibits an automatic stop of the engine. When a preceding vehicle is located in the first predetermined area, the automatic stop restricting function is deactivated.

Method and control unit for carrying out an engine stop of an internal combustion engine
A control unit is provided for a vehicle having an internal combustion engine with a shaft, which can be coupled to an electric machine or decoupled from the electric machine. The control unit is designed to couple the electric machine to the internal combustion engine during an engine stop of the internal combustion engine. The control unit causes the electric machine to guide the shaft of the internal combustion engine. The control unit determines that a speed of the guided shaft is equal to or less than a speed threshold value and, in response thereto, decouples the electric machine from the internal combustion engine, such that the internal combustion engine stops without being guided by the electric machine.
Idling-stop control apparatus
An idling-stop control apparatus includes an idling-stop controller and an auxiliary-machine controller. The idling-stop controller is configured to automatically stop an engine to cause the engine to be in a state in which idling is stopped in a case where a predetermined condition for stopping idling is satisfied and configured to automatically restart the engine in a case where a predetermined condition for restarting the engine is satisfied. The auxiliary-machine controller is configured to control a drive state of an auxiliary machine that is to be driven by the engine. The auxiliary-machine controller is configured to control the drive state of the auxiliary machine that is driven by the engine such that, in a case where the engine is automatically restarted from the state in which idling is stopped by the idling-stop controller, a time differential value of an engine speed of the engine is constant.
Method for Starting an Internal Combustion Engine of a Motor Vehicle, and Motor Vehicle Comprising an Internal Combustion Engine
A method for starting an internal combustion engine and a motor vehicle are provided. The internal combustion engine includes a plurality of cylinders. To start the internal combustion engine while deactivated, a predefined amount of working gas is introduced into the cylinder that fires first. A crankshaft of the internal combustion engine is driven by an electric motor and by the movement of a piston coupled to the crankshaft and associated with the cylinder that fires first to introduce the predefined amount of working gas. Subsequently, the internal combustion engine is started by the ignition of a mixture including the predefined amount of working gas and a predefined amount of fuel inside the cylinder that fires first.
METHOD FOR CONTROLLING START OF ENGINE-DRIVEN GENERATOR
An engine-driven generator may comprise an engine, a generator, a motor, a battery, a power supply circuit, and a processor. The processor may be configured to detect that the battery has a sufficient power supply capability that enables a piston of the engine to pass over a compression top dead center, at the start of the engine. The processor may permit ignition of the engine in a case where the processor has detected that the battery has the sufficient power supply capability. The processor may avoid the ignition of the engine in a case where the processor has not detected that the battery has the sufficient power supply capability.

Internal Combustion Engine for a Motor Vehicle, in Particular for a Car
An internal combustion engine of a motor vehicle includes an output shaft and a spring element which can rotate with the output shaft which is to be tensioned as a result of a deactivation of the internal combustion engine by a rotation of the output shaft, where a spring force can be provided by the spring element and where by the spring force the output shaft can be set into rotation in the event of a start following the deactivation. Via a locking device the output shaft is to be secured against a rotation after tensioning the spring element and while the spring element is tensioned. A blocking device can be shifted between a blocking state securing a first part of the spring element, which has a second part non-rotationally connected to the output shaft, against a rotation and a release state releasing the first part for a rotation.
SYSTEM FOR CONTROLLING STARTING OF ENGINE
In an engine starting system, a first controller activates, in response to a driver's starting request, a first starting device to rotate the rotating shaft of an engine. A second controller is communicably connected to the first controller. The second controller recognizes rotation of the rotor of a second starting device resulting from an activation of the first starting device. The second controller starts a power running operation of the second starting device based on the recognition of the rotation of the rotor. The first controller determines whether the power running operation of the second starting device has been started. The first controller deactivates, when it is determined that the power running operation has been started, the first starting device before a rotational angular position of the rotating shaft of the engine arrives at a compression top dead center of the engine.
